Output 2859e81c3b43ba1f81c537b1cfab24f42f7536a64bac789d5c19bdb0bae15a56:0

value
15814444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08261505151ba8756f38e480e3a8016318ed8e2a OP_EQUAL
address
M8eFFxQhi98B8QHQ3zTKTbwGjXGThwh9HN
transaction
2859e81c3b43ba1f81c537b1cfab24f42f7536a64bac789d5c19bdb0bae15a56
spent
true